Maharashtra Committee Calls for Strict Action Against Child Marriages in Nashik
Maharashtra Committee Seeks Strict Action on Child Marriages

The three-day Maharashtra Legislature's Committee on Women's and Children's Rights and Welfare, led by MLA Monica Rajale, has called for strict action against child marriages during its visit to Nashik District. The committee includes MLAs Manisha Kayande, Manjula Gavit, and Seema Hiray.

Committee's Emphasis on Stringent Measures

According to a senior officer from Nashik Zilla Parishad, the committee stressed taking complaints regarding child marriage and women's safety with utmost seriousness. The members visited various government offices and institutions in Dindori taluka to inspect their operations.

Inspections and Visits

The committee visited the tribal girls' hostel in Dindori taluka, the primary health centre in Talegaon, the 'Adarsh AI Anganwadi Centre' in Vanarwadi, and Sahyadri Farms. They gathered information about training programmes for farmers. They also visited the Dindori Panchayat Samiti, Dindori police station, and the 'Adarsh gram panchayat' of Avankhed, engaging in dialogue with the sarpanch and villagers about local initiatives.

Highlight: Modern Anganwadi Centre

The 'Adarsh AI Anganwadi Centre' in Vanarwadi, established to provide high-quality early childhood education using modern technology, was a highlight. The ZP Nashik officer added that Chairperson Rajale praised the anganwadi, noting that such modern and attractive centres in rural areas would cultivate a love for learning among children and boost attendance rates. She said efforts would be made to replicate them across the state.

Fund Utilization and Reporting

The officer also stated that the committee asked the zilla parishad and Nashik Municipal Corporation to ensure that allocated funds for women and children welfare schemes are utilized within the stipulated timeframe. The committee further instructed government departments to regularly apprise elected representatives of schemes related to women and child development.
